Programming

The Role of the Programmer in Web Development

1 April 2025

In today’s digital world, web development is a cornerstone for the operation of businesses, brands, and personal projects. Behind every website we visit, there is a team of professionals working on its creation and maintenance. One of the key players in this process is the programmer. But what exactly is the programmer’s role in web development? Below, we’ll explore their role and how they contribute to the success of a digital project.

1. Website Design and Structure

The programmer’s role in web development starts with the foundation: creating the structure and functionality of a site. While the visual design of a website is the responsibility of the designer, the programmer is tasked with bringing that vision to life. This involves converting designs into functional code, ensuring that the website is interactive, responsive (adaptable to different devices), and easy to navigate.

2. Developing Logic and Functionality

One of the most important aspects of the programmer’s role is developing the logic behind how a website functions. This includes creating databases, programming contact forms, integrating payment systems, and more. The programmer also ensures that all site features operate correctly, from buttons to more complex functionalities like search filters or login systems.

3. Optimization and Performance

A key component of the programmer’s job is website optimization. This includes improving load speed, code efficiency, and cross-browser compatibility. A fast and well-optimized website is crucial for providing a good user experience, which leads to higher retention rates and better rankings on search engines. The programmer must always be aware of best practices to ensure the site is accessible and functional at all times.

4. Web Security

Security is another vital aspect of the programmer’s work. In a world where cyber threats are ever-present, it is the programmer’s responsibility to implement security measures to protect both user data and the integrity of the site. This involves creating authentication protocols, encrypting sensitive data, and implementing defenses against attacks like hacking or phishing.

5. Maintenance and Updates

The programmer’s work doesn’t end with the website launch. Ongoing maintenance is crucial to ensure the site continues to function correctly. This includes updating platforms, fixing bugs, adding new features, and improving performance. A programmer must also be ready to address any technical issues that may arise after launch, ensuring the site is always available and operating efficiently.

Conclusion

The programmer’s role in web development is essential in turning an idea into a functional and successful digital experience. From creating the basic structure to optimizing performance and ensuring security, the programmer ensures that the website meets technical standards and provides a smooth user experience. Web development is a constantly evolving field, and the programmer plays a crucial role in keeping sites up to date with the latest technologies and trends.